Oil drilling is divided into exploration wells and production wells according to the purpose of drilling. According to the well trajectory can be divided into vertical wells and directional wells. According to the environmental conditions of drilling operations, it is divided into onshore drilling and offshore drilling. According to the well depth, it can be divided into shallow well, medium-deep well, deep well, ultra-deep well, ultra-deep well and so on. 1. exploration and production wells
(I) exploration well
Exploration wells are wells drilled for the purpose of obtaining geological data, including geological wells, pre-exploration wells, detailed exploration wells, evaluation wells, etc. Exploration wells are generally vertical wells.
(1) Pre-exploration wells: refers to wells drilled for the discovery of oil and gas reservoirs in favorable circles determined by seismic detailed investigation and comprehensive geological research, including wells drilled for the discovery of new oil and gas reservoirs in known oil fields.
(2) Detailed exploration well: refers to the well drilled in the discovered oil and gas circle to find out the oil and gas boundary and reserves, and to understand the structure of oil and gas layer and oil production capacity.
(3) Evaluation well: refers to the well drilled to find out the oil and gas-bearing area and geological reserves of the trap after the discovery of the oil and gas-bearing reservoir in the pre-exploration well.
Due to the unknown formation conditions and the need to take cores and geological data, it takes a long time and costs a high cost to drill exploration wells. Movable drilling units are generally used to drill exploration wells offshore.
(II) production well
Production wells, also known as development wells, are wells drilled for oil and gas production in the oil field development stage, including oil (gas) wells, water injection (gas) wells, adjustment wells, etc. Generally, no core is taken when drilling production wells, the formation conditions are clear, the drilling speed is fast, and the cost is low.
(1) Oil (gas) wells: In the development of oil fields, the wells drilled for the exploitation of oil and natural gas can be divided into oil production wells and gas production wells.
(2) Water injection (gas) wells: in order to improve the recovery rate of oil fields for water injection, gas injection, to supplement and rational use of formation energy drilled wells, but also can be divided into positive injection wells (from the tubing to the formation of water injection wells) and reverse injection wells (from the casing to the formation of water injection wells).
(3) Adjustment wells: on the basis of the original well network, some scattered wells or encrypted wells in batches are drilled to improve the effect of oil field development.

2. directional well
In oil drilling, in addition to vertical wells, according to certain purposes and requirements, wells drilled along the design trajectory are called directional wells, including horizontal wells and deviated wells. With the development and improvement of drilling technology, in order to meet the needs of oil and gas field exploitation, since the 1990 s, highly deviated wells, horizontal wells and large displacement wells are the direction of development.
(I) horizontal well
Horizontal well refers to the design. The inclination angle of the large well is between 86 ° and 120 °, and a certain length of the well is drilled along the (near) horizontal direction. Horizontal well technology has been developed since the 1990 s because horizontal wells can increase the exposed area of the developed oil layer, increase the oil production of the oil layer and the recovery rate of the oil field. Horizontal wells can be divided into long, medium, short, short four kinds of curvature radius. Horizontal well drilling is relatively difficult, most of which require special equipment, drilling tools, tools, instruments and special processes.
(II) slope well
Deviated wells are designed. Wells with large well inclination angle not more than 85 ° can be divided into low-angle well, medium-angle well and high-angle well, among which medium-angle well is used more frequently.
(III) cluster well
During the development of oil fields, due to the limitations of ground and environmental conditions, as well as the requirements of rational use of land resources, it is often necessary to drill several or dozens of directional wells and a vertical well in a planned way on a well site or platform. These wells are collectively referred to as cluster wells. The distance between wellheads of cluster wells (well spacing) is generally 2~3m. Cluster wells can reduce the construction cost of well site or platform, and facilitate the production management of oil wells, which is widely used in offshore oil field development.
